TAMPA — An aide to U.S. Senator and presidential candidate Marco Rubio has taken a post as a lobbyist for the Tampa Bay Partnership.

Ryan Patmintra, Tampa-based regional director for Rubio, will start his role as vice president of public policy and advocacy at the partnership Jan. 11, according to a statement.

As a result of his time with the presidential candidate, Patmintra “understands the issues affecting our community and is uniquely positioned to address them in both Tallahassee and Washington D.C.,” partnership CEO Rick Homans says a statement.
